Ingredients
2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
1 package (8 oz) bread stuffing mix
2 cups chicken broth
1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
1/2 cup milk
1/2 cup celery, diced
1/2 cup onion, diced
1 tsp garlic powder
Salt and pepper to taste

Servings and Cooking Time
This recipe serves 6 people. Preparation time is about 15 minutes, with a cooking time of 30-35 minutes.
Nutritional Value
Each serving (1/6 of the casserole) contains approximately 350 calories, 15g fat, 30g carbohydrates, and 25g protein. This nutritional information is based on one serving for one person.
Step-by-Step Cooking Process
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, combine the shredded chicken, diced celery, and onion.
- In another bowl, mix together the bread stuffing mix, chicken broth, cream of chicken soup, and milk.
- Add the chicken mixture to the stuffing mixture and stir until well combined.
- Season with garlic powder, salt, and pepper to taste.
- Transfer the mixture to a greased baking dish.
- Spread the mixture evenly in the dish.
- Bake uncovered for 30-35 minutes until the top is golden brown.
- Remove from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es.
- Serve warm and enjoy your delicious casserole!

Alternative Ingredients
You can substitute the chicken with turkey for a post-holiday dish. Additionally, gluten-free bread stuffing is available for a gluten-free version, and homemade cream of chicken soup can replace canned soup for a fresher taste.
Serving and Pairings
Serve this casserole with a side of steamed vegetables, a fresh garden salad, or mashed potatoes for a complete meal. It pairs wonderfully with cranberry sauce or a light vinaigrette.
Storage and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place in the oven at 350°F until warmed through. This casserole can also be frozen for up to 3 months; thaw in the fridge before reheating.
Cooking Mistakes
- Using too much liquid can make the casserole soggy.
- Not shredding the chicken properly can lead to uneven cooking.
- Overbaking can dry out the dish.
- Forgetting to season can result in bland flavors.
- Using stale bread can affect texture.
Helpful Tips
- Use leftover chicken for a quicker prep.
- Mix in some vegetables like peas or carrots for added nutrition.
- Cover with foil for the first 20 minutes of baking to retain moisture.
- Taste and adjust seasonings before baking.

FAQs
Can I use frozen chicken?
Yes, you can use cooked frozen chicken. Just ensure it is thoroughly thawed and shredded before mixing it into the casserole.
How can I make this dish vegetarian?
For a vegetarian version, replace the chicken with cooked mushrooms or a mixture of hearty vegetables and use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th.
Can I prepare this casserole 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the casserole a day in advance. Just assemble it, cover tightly, and refrigerate until ready to bake.
What type of bread stuffing is best?
A herb-flavored bread stuffing works best, but you can choose any variety based on your preference.
How do I know when the casserole is done?
The casserole is done when the top is golden brown and the mixture is bubbly around the edges. A toothpick should come out clean when inserted in the center.
